The mass of an electron is significantly smaller than that of a proton. In fact, an electron's mass is approximately 1/1836 of a proton's mass. This means that a proton is roughly 1836 times more massive than an electron.

When considering the choices, the correct understanding aligns with the concept that the mass ratio is not a multiple of the electron's mass being larger, but rather how many times larger the proton is in comparison to the electron. The value that accurately represents how many times larger a proton is compared to an electron is 1840, which is close to the commonly accepted value of 1836.

Thus, the correct answer reflects the fundamental understanding of particle mass in atomic structure, specifically that protons are substantially heavier than electrons.
